P3 Gauge fitting
Pretty easy, only 2 things to be carful with. see red arrows in the pics
1. The tabs on top of the vent will break if you just try and pull the vent out. A bit of care is required to remove. Not difficult. 2. The small wire has a wee tab that locks it in place. Just remove the connecter completely turn it upside down to reveal the tap and use a small screw driver to help unclip it I ran the OBD cable down inside the plastic steering cover and out the bottom. I did not like the idea of running the wire down the side and squeezing it in-between the foot-well plastic covers as it would rub and possible rub through in time. Overall happy with the gauge and functionality
